Model Showcase: Y-Wing (Fine Molds)
My first styrene kit in ages, and my first styrene kit airbrushed as well. Met with a little trepidation, but eventually weathered it well enough to be happy with it. Fun little kit, and the pipes and details do an excellent job hiding the seams and joins.

Model Showcase: Fine Molds Snowspeeder
This was my second Fine Molds kit to do, and quite a breeze to put together. First kit that I ever eschewed decals for masking and painting as well. While that is now my preferred method, there are still some instances I have to use decals as opposed to actual paint.
Model Showcase: Fine Molds TIE Fighter (1/48 scale)
This was a fairly fun kit to put together. Fine Molds did a fantastic job making the pieces fit together in a logical fashion, minimizing work after the fact.
Model Showcase: Moebius Batpod
Here's the Moebius Batpod I did from the second Dark Knight movie. Moebius typically does decent kits, but their real claim to fame is hitting the subjects a lot of other companies don't.
